Why Traditional Pillows Often Fall Short
Most standard pillows are designed with a one-size-fits-all mentality, but sleep is anything but uniform. Everyone has different body types, sleeping preferences, and physical needs. Traditional pillows often fail because they don’t account for the natural curve of your neck and spine. Imagine trying to sleep on a blanket that’s too small – you’d end up with gaps and discomfort. That’s exactly what happens when your pillow doesn’t match your body’s requirements. Many people experience neck pain or stiffness upon waking because their traditional pillow either doesn’t provide enough support or creates an awkward angle for their head and neck. The problem becomes even more complex when you consider that people change sleeping positions throughout the night. A pillow that works great for back sleeping might be completely inadequate for side sleeping, and vice versa.
